It was written for her by composer Arthur Kent and lyricist Sylvia Dee, and recorded in the RCA Studios in Nashville on June 8, 1962. It was released in December 1962 and reached No 2 in America and No 18 in Britain early in 1963. It was produced by Chet Atkins and was played at his funeral in 2001.
